CKOA-FM is a Canadian radio station, broadcasting at 89.7 FM in Glace Bay, Nova Scotia. Owned and operated by the Coastal Community Radio Cooperative, the station broadcasts a community radio format branded as The Coast 89.7.
The station was licensed by the CRTC in 2007, and went on the air on December 3 of that year.[1]
The Coastal Community Radio Cooperative began life as a low-powered 50-watt special events station, broadcasting from various locations and temporary studios in Glace Bay and Sydney, NS.
